Mini Apple Pies w. Cinnamon & Cardamom Boiled Apples – Små Äppelpajer med Kanel & Kardemumma kokta Äpplen

Recipe (makes 8 small pies) / Recept (8 små pajer)

Bottom dough / Botten deg

3 tbsp of butter / 3 msk smör

2.5 tbsp of flour / 2.5 msk mjöl

1 tbsp sugar / 1 msk socker

Top dough / Top deg 

3 tbsp of butter / 3 msk smör

2.5 tbsp of old fashioned rolled oats / 2.5 msk havregryn

1 tbsp sugar / 1 msk socker

Apples / Äpplen 

2 apples / 2 äpplen

1.5 tsp cardamom / 1.5 tsk kardemumma

1.5 tsp of cinnamon / 1.5 tsk kanel

1 tsp of sugar / 1 tsk socker

1 tsp syrup / 1 tsk sirap

1 tbsp of butter / 1 msk smör

1. Start by preheating the oven to 400. / Sätt ugnen på 200 grader.

2. Cut the apples in small pieces. / Skär äpplena i små bitar.

3. Put the apples and all apple ingredients in a pot. / Lägg äpplen och alla äpple ingredienser i en kastrull.

4. Bring to boil, reduce heat and cook for about 7-10 min. / Koka upp, skruva ner värmen och låt puttra i ca 7-10 min.

5. Mix all the ingredients to the bottom dough. / Blanda alla ingredienser till under-degen.

6. Push out in aluminum molds in a muffin thin. / Tryck ut i botten på aluminiumformar i en muffinplåt.

7. Fill up with apples. / Fyll på med äpplen.

8. Mix all ingredients to the top dough. / Blanda alla ingredienser till topp degen.

9. Spread the crumbles on top of the apples. / Bred ut smulorna på toppen av äpplena.

10. Bake for about 15 min or until golden. / Grädda i ca 15 min eller tills gyllene.

11. Done! / Klart!

Mini Scones w. Cinnamon & Cranberries – Mini Scones med Kanel och Tranbär

Every time I make scones, I think of my mom. She was the scones “master” in our house, and it was always a really happy, and really good day when I walked down the stairs to our kitchen, and the whole kitchen smelled like scones. Now a days, there’s not as many scones baked or made, but whenever I do make them, it makes me happy. As I’ve mentioned in this post, we usually bake scones in a different way than people do in the US. Last time I baked, I used a muffin thin in order to make the scones smaller and more symmetric. I added some cinnamon to half of the dough, and some dried cranberries to the other half. The scones turned out super cute and delicious. I believe scones are the absolute best right out of the oven with butter and a cup of coffee :).

Recipe / Recept

2 cups of flour / 5 dl mjöl

2 tsp of baking powder / 2 tsk bakpulver

1 tsp of salt / 1 tsk salt

0.8 cups of milk (soy or rice works as well as regular) / 2 dl mjölk (soya eller ris funkar lika bra som vanlig)

5 tbsp of butter (about 2/3 of a stick) / 75 g smör

some cinnamon / lite kanel 

some cranberries / like torkade tranbär

1. Preheat the oven to 480 F. / Sätt ugnen på 250 grader.

2. Mix flour, baking powder and salt in a bowl. / Blanda mjöl, salt och bakpulver i en bunke.

3. Add the milk. / Tillsätt mjölken.

4. Cut the butter in pieces and mix it in with your hands. / Skär smöret i bitar och blanda till en deg med hjälp av dina händer.

5. Part the dough in two. / Dela degen i två.

6. Add cinnamon to one part, and cranberries to the other. / Lägg i kanel i den ena delen och tranbär i den andra.

7. Prepare a muffin thin. / Förbered en muffinplåt.

8. Part the dough’s in 8’s (making 16 scones in total). / Dela degarna i 8. Det blir 16 scones totalt.

9. Roll into small balls and put in the thin. / Rulla små bollar och lägg i plåten.

10. Take a fork and pick on the top of the scones. / Ta en gaffel och picka på toppen av sconsen.

11.  Bake for about 12-15 minutes or until golden. / Grädda i ca 12-15 min eller tills gyllene.

12. Serve immediately. / Servera direkt.

13. Done! / Klart!

Addicting Banana & Nutella Muffins – Beroendeframkallande Banan och Nutella Muffins

These Muffins. I don’t even know how to explain them. First of all, the MUFFIN. I’m not usually a huge fan to be honest, I feel like muffins can be kind of dull. But these…. Are moist, not to sweet, bananay and just delicious! And then comes the frosting….. Which I found on Sally’s Baking Addiction and slightly modified, was a DREAM. in combination…. Unresistibly, deliciously addicting banana and nutella muffins. A must try.

Recipe / Recept 

Muffins 

2/3 cups of butter / 75 g smör 

1.5 cups of flour / 3 dl mjöl

3 bananas / 3 bananer

1 egg / 1 ägg

3/4 cups of sugar / ca 2 dl socker 

2 tsp of baking powder / 2 tsk bakpulver

a little salt / lite salt 

Frosting 

1.5 sticks of butter / 150 g smör

2 cups of powdered sugar / 5 dl florsocker 

4 large tbsp of nutella / 4 stora msk nutella 

4 tbsp of milk / 4 msk mjölk

1. Preheat the oven to 350 F. / Sätt ugnen på 175 grader.

2. Melt the butter. / Smält smöret.

3. Mash the banana. / Mosa bananen.

4. Mix all the ingredients together. / Blanda alla ingredienser.

5. Bake in the oven for about 20 min or until a little golden. / Grädda i ugnen i ca 20 min, eller tills gyllene.

6. Let cool. / Låt svalna.

7. Whisk the butter for the frosting fluffy. / Vispa smöret till frostingen fluffigt.

8. Mix in the sugar. / Vispa i sockret.

9. Whisk in the nutella. / Vispa i nutellan.

10. Whisk in the milk. /  Vispa i mjölken.

11. Frost the cupcakes. If you’re uncertain of how, I made this video. / Frosta muffinsen. Om du känner dig osäker på hur, gjorde jag denna video.

12. Done! / Klart!
